What is the Medicare Coordination Acknowledgement Form?

The Medicare Coordination Acknowledgement Form is a critical document for retirees of The Texas A&M University System. Its primary purpose is to acknowledge the understanding of Medicare coverage and its coordination with A&M System health plans. This retiree Medicare form plays an essential role in ensuring that retirees are enrolled in both Medicare Parts A and B when eligible, as the A&M System health coverage is secondary to Medicare.
This form emphasizes the importance of Medicare acknowledgment, highlighting that retirees must be well-informed about their coverage options and how they align with A&M System benefits.

Key Features of the Medicare Coordination Acknowledgement Form

The Medicare Coordination Acknowledgement Form contains several critical components that facilitate the acknowledgment of Medicare coverage. Key features include:
  • Fillable fields for essential retiree information such as name, UIN, and Social Security number.
  • Signature lines that validate the accuracy of the submitted information.

Who Needs the Medicare Coordination Acknowledgement Form?

Primarily, the Medicare Coordination Acknowledgement Form is designed for retirees of The Texas A&M University System. Eligibility criteria for completing this form typically include:
  • Individuals who are retired from The Texas A&M University System.
  • Those who are eligible for Medicare and its associated benefits.
Non-compliance with this requirement may affect retirees' access to Medicare coverage, impacting their healthcare options.
